Man Jailed For Posting Exodus Lyrics To Facebook Speaks To Billboard
The man arrested for posting lyrics by metal band Exodus in August to his Facebook has opened up about his experiences. "It's surreal," 31-year-old James Evans said in an interview with Billboard recently. "I didn't think anything would come of it." -
